Name origin and meaning
The name Brive is strongly associated with a major town in south-central France, suggesting a likely geographical or toponymic origin. In ancient times, the root element possibly relates to a bridge or river crossing point, reflecting its physical location. Some theories connect the linguistic root to an older Celtic term, potentially *Brivo*, signifying a crossing or causeway. Therefore, the implied meaning often relates to connection or passage over water. While predominantly known as a place name, its structure allows for interpretation as derived from these ancient roots.
